The East End of London
The multi-cultural district of Leyton has many things to offer new home owners and businesses. Like much of the East End it is undergoing gentrification and is a revitalized community. The former high-rise estates have been demolished and rebuilt allowing the residents to improve the community over the last 10 years with fantastic results. The newly rejuvenated district is now home to Asda, and Tesco, as well as a renewed sense of pride in the old sporting icons of Matchroom Stadium and Leyton Cricket Ground.
Shopping in Leyton
The New Spitfields Market, was opened in 1991, and is the leading exotic fruit and vegetables market in Britain. With 115 fruit, flower and vegetable wholesalers, modern cold storage and ripening rooms Leyton residents and visitors have little trouble finding the right fruit or vegetable for exotic dishes.
A large 24 hour Asda opened in 2009 and is conveniently located just opposite the tube station. Combined with two Tesco’s in Leyton Bakers Arm, and Leytonstone shopping is easy and cheap.
Sports in Leyton
The Matchroom Stadium on Brisbane Road is the home of the Leyton Orient F.C. and the Tottenham Hotspur F.C. reserves. To add to its popularity amongst residents and fans, it has hosted a number of matches for the England U-16 and England Women’s teams. The Women’s League Cup final was hosted at the stadium in 2008. For Leyton football fans it’s a popular attraction.
Leyton Cricket Ground has held a popular place for cricketers of Leyton since it was built in 1885. It was the headquarters for the County Cricket Club until 1933, now it is used by the Leyton County Cricket Club and local schools.
Moving to E10
Getting to and from Leyton is fairly easy with four London Underground stations, in or close to the district. The stations of Leyton, Leytonstone, Stratford, and Walthamstow Central, allow residents to use the Central, Victoria and Jubilee Lines.
The Leyton Midland Road Railway Station is on the Gospel Oak to Barking Line, trains running in both direction leave every 30 minutes, providing reliable service everyday.
Leyton residents have access to 24 hour buses, that move along the Lea Bridge Road and High Road, allowing residents to move throughout the area and city with ease.
